Job Purpose
I am 24 years old and have Duchene Muscular Dystrophy, I live at home with my parents and our dog. I am looking for a new personal assistant, to join my team to support me on a 1:1 basis.
The role involves not only providing practical care and assistance but also encouraging and enabling me to maintain my independence, pursue my interests and stay actively engaged in the activities I enjoy. A supportive, patient, and positive approach will help me feel confident and motivated in my day-to-day life.
I am happiest at home. I enjoy music, art and gaming. Occasionally I enjoy going to cinemas, pubs and shops. I also have numerous appointments to attend in local hospitals.
Personal care:
Provide full support with all aspects of personal care including washing, dressing, brushing teeth and shaving ensuring hygiene, comfort and dignity at all times.
Nutrition & Medication:
Support with preparing and assisting with a soft diet, due to weakness in my arms I require support with feeding.
Assistance with medication, following the prescribed scheduled and maintaining accurate records.
Domestic duties:
Support with domestic duties around the home included preparing meals and drinks.
Perform any other duties that are of a reasonable request.
All training will be provided.
